Blood in the stool is the most common symptom of anorectal disease, but there are many kinds of blood in the stool, not every kind of blood in the stool is caused by anorectal disease. The most likely cause of anal diseases hemorrhoids blood in the stool, when you always appear after each stool anal drip blood, color or bright red, you can consider whether it is suffering from hemorrhoids. With this type of blood in the stool, the stool and blood are usually separated and do not appear to be mixed together. Hemorrhoids can manifest only as fresh blood in the stool or at the same time as a swelling felt in the anus after a bowel movement. Simply put, bright red blood in the stool that appears after a bowel movement is generally suspected of hemorrhoids. When there is fresh blood dripping from the stool and anal pain is evident during the stool, you should suspect anal fissure. There is also a rare case where the amount of blood is small, mixed with pus, and there is localized redness and swelling in the anus, which is likely to be a perianal abscess.  Of course, there are other diseases that can also have blood in the stool, such as rectal polyps, this kind of blood in the stool, mainly on the surface of a blood stain, like a brush on a brush; secondly, rectal tumors, especially the lower location of the tumor, will also appear blood in the stool, tumor patients are often accompanied by weight loss, weight loss in a short period of time, most rectal tumor patients blood in the stool, blood and stool mixed, can be distinguished from In most rectal tumor patients, blood and stool are mixed, which can be distinguished from hemorrhoids; or, for example, ulcerative colitis, Crohn’s disease, etc., there will be blood in stool, but the color is mostly pink, mixed with pus and mucus, called mucopurulent stool.  What requires more attention is when black stools are present. Black stool can be seen as an evolved version of blood stool. Once or twice in a while, you can first think about whether you have used animal blood foods such as duck blood or pig blood on the first day. If not, you should suspect whether it is gastrointestinal bleeding, especially black, tar-like stool, you need to immediately consult the hospital emergency or gastroenterology, because the acute gastrointestinal bleeding is very high risk.  2, the anal swelling is what happened?  Many friends will mention that the anus is swollen when they are unable to see a doctor on site, telephone or information consultation, so what is going on with the anal swelling? A variety of anorectal diseases can cause the anus to swell up, but they swell in different ways, we can simply distinguish. The most common, usually feel the anus is not flat, there is a tug or bump, once the end of the bowel movement to become larger, take a hand to push a push can also be retracted, this is the swelling of hemorrhoids, swollen part is the external hemorrhoids and prolapsed internal hemorrhoids; if found after the bowel movement swollen, take a hand to push can not return, there is unbearable pain, you can see pink tissue stuck in the outside of the anus, this is embedded hemorrhoids, need to see the anorectal department The first thing you need to do is to see an anorectal doctor for early treatment; furthermore, if the swollen area is red and you feel feverish and painful, or even if you have a fever that doesn’t go away, it’s likely to be a perianal abscess, so you should look for an anorectal doctor. Different anal diseases often lead to different types of pain. Anal fissures are most likely to cause anal pain, tear-like or knife-like pain in the anus during stool, and sudden spasmodic sharp pain after a period of time, which can be basically identified as anal fissures; the embedded hemorrhoids mentioned in the second article will also have anal pain, which is a kind of intense pain, and the internal hemorrhoid tissue stuck outside the anus can be felt or seen locally in the anus, which can be easily distinguished from other diseases; when the anus appears The pain of perianal abscess is also easy to distinguish, mainly heat pain and swelling pain, and local redness and swelling can also be seen.
